DEVICE-BASED GEOSPATIAL FILTERING FOR BAROMETRIC PRESSURE SENSOR CALIBRATION
A server generates a gridded geospatial filter map that encompasses the location of a mobile device. The gridded geospatial filter map indicates a first region that is not conducive to calibrating a barometric pressure sensor of the mobile device and a second region that is conducive to calibrating the barometric pressure sensor. The first region and the second region include sub-tiles of the gridded geospatial filter map. The mobile device determines whether the location is conducive to calibrating the barometric pressure sensor based on the location being encompassed by one of the sub-tiles. When the sub-tile is in the second region, the mobile device sends to the server calibration data generated by the barometric pressure sensor, and the server calibrates the barometric pressure sensor using the calibration data. When the sub-tile is in the first region, the mobile device causes the calibration data not to be used.

Altitude Determination With Relative Pressure Change
A pressure change is detected based on pressure measurement data from a barometric pressure sensor of a computing device. A 2D location of the computing device is determined. An altitude change of the computing device is determined using the pressure change. A cumulative altitude offset value is determined by adding the altitude change to a previous cumulative altitude offset value. A terrain-based altitude of the computing device is determined based on the 2D location and terrain data from a geodatabase. An altitude of the computing device is determined based on the terrain-based altitude and the cumulative altitude offset value.

Correcting HVAC Effect on Pressure Sensor Measurement
A location context indicates whether a computing device is in an HVAC environment or a non-HVAC environment. When the computing device is in the HVAC environment, an expected altitude of the computing device is obtained, and a measured altitude of the computing device is determined. An altitude difference is determined between the expected altitude and the measured altitude. The HVAC effect is determined based on the altitude difference. A pressure sensor of the computing device is calibrated based on the HVAC effect, or a corrected measured altitude of the computing device is estimated based on the HVAC effect. In some cases, instead of the altitude difference, the HVAC effect is determined based on a pressure difference.

Field calibration of a pressure device involves collecting simultaneous pressure data or pressure and temperature data at two devices for multiple time points. Pressure differences between pairs of simultaneous data points of the collected pressure data are calculated. A model is fitted to the pressure differences and the temperatures and/or pressures, and model parameters are used to correct measurements from the second device. Alternatively, a pressure gradient is estimated for a region that encompasses the two devices for each time point. A distance is determined between the two devices. A pressure gradient difference is determined between the two devices for each time point. A pressure difference offset is obtained for one of the pairs of simultaneous data points for each time point. An average pressure difference offset is determined between the two devices and is used to correct measurements from one of the devices.

DETERMINATION OF ALTITUDE UNCERTAINTY INCLUDING TEMPERATURE LAPSE RATE
A calculated current lapse rate is determined for a geographical area that includes a location of a mobile device. The calculated current lapse rate provides an estimated air temperature variation with respect to altitude variation for the location of the mobile device. An altitude of the mobile device is estimated. An uncertainty of the altitude of the mobile device is estimated based on a reference pressure and a reference temperature for a reference plane that is within the geographical area, a device pressure for the mobile device, and the calculated current lapse rate.

Systems and methods for determining which reference-level pressures are used when estimating an altitude of a mobile device
Determining which reference-level pressures, from among a plurality of available reference-level pressures, are used when estimating an altitude of a mobile device. Different systems and methods determine isobars based on reference-level pressures of weather stations, and then use the isobars in different ways to identify particular reference-level pressures for use in estimated an altitude of a mobile device. One approach determines the smallest distance between an initial estimated position of a mobile device and a neighboring isobar, and then uses that distance to identify reference-level pressures. Another approach identifies reference-level pressures between an isobar on which an initial estimated position of a mobile device is location and a neighboring isobar. Yet another approach compares the number of identified reference-level pressures and/or locations of the identified reference-level pressures against threshold conditions before determining which reference-level pressures to use.
